html制作图片跳动(html图片跳转)
华为云服务器特价优惠火热进行中! 2核2G2兆仅需 38 元;4核4G3兆仅需 79 元。购买时间越长越优惠!更多配置及优惠价格请咨询客服。
合作流程: |
本篇文章给大家谈谈html制作图片跳动,以及html图片跳转对应的知识点,希望对各位有所帮助,不要忘了收藏本站喔。
微信号:cloud7591如需了解更多,欢迎添加客服微信咨询。
复制微信号
本文目录一览:
- 1、如何在HTML中实现图片的滚动效果?
- 2、在html中如何让图片跟着滚动条而动
- 3、html怎么设置滚动图片?
- 4、HTML 图片闪烁????
- 5、html如何使图片移动
- 6、html中鼠标放上去图片上下跳动一下
如何在HTML中实现图片的滚动效果?
素材的准备。为了更好的表现网站的风格和特色,具备一些更富表现力和吸引力的图片是必不可少的。同理,小编也准备了一些与网页主题密切相关的图片,用于做为实现图片滚动效果的素材。
打开Dreamweaver8,新建一网页文件,并保存为名为“index.html"文件。
切换至代码编辑界面,输入如下代码:
bodydiv id="photo-list" ul id="scroll"
lia href="#"img src="images/1.jpg" width="100px" height="100px" alt=""//a/li
lia href="#"img src="images/2.jpg" width="100px" height="100px" alt=""//a/li
lia href="#"img src="images/3.jpg" width="100px" height="100px" alt=""//a/li
lia href="#"img src="images/4.jpg" width="100px" height="100px" alt=""//a/li
lia href="#"img src="images/5.jpg" width="100px" height="100px" alt=""//a/li
lia href="#"img src="images/6.jpg" width="100px" height="100px" alt=""//a/li /ul /div/body
新建一CSS样式表文件,并将该文件保存到与“index.html”相同的目录下,文件名称为“MyStyle.css"。
在新建的样式表文件"MyStyle.css”文件中输入如下代码:
* { padding:0; margin:0;} /*设置所有对像的内边距为0*/
body { text-align:center;} /*设置页面居中对齐*/
#photo-list {
/* 6张图片的宽度(包含宽度、padding、border、图片间的留白)
计算:6*(100+2*2+1*2+9) - 9
之所以减去9是第6张图片的右边留白 */
width:681px;
/* 图片的宽度(包含高度、padding、border)
计算:100+2*2+1*2 */
height:106px;
margin:50px auto;
overflow:hidden; /*溢出部份将被隐藏*/
border:1px dashed #ccc;
}
#photo-list ul { list-style:none;}
#photo-list li { float:left; padding-right:9px;}
#photo-list img { border:1px solid #ddd; background:#fff; padding:2px;}
在网页文件"index.html"中添加对该样式表的引用:
link rel="stylesheet" type="text/css" href="MyStyle.css"
新建一个JS文件,并将该文件另存为“MoveEffect.js"。
在”MoveEffect.js“文件中输入如下所示代码:
var id = function(el) { return document.getElementById(el); },
c = id('photo-list');
if(c) {
var ul = id('scroll'),
lis = ul.getElementsByTagName('li'),
itemCount = lis.length,
width = lis[0].offsetWidth, //获得每个img容器的宽度
marquee = function() {
c.scrollLeft += 2;
if(c.scrollLeft % width = 1){ //当 c.scrollLeft 和 width 相等时,把第一个img追加到最后面
ul.appendChild(ul.getElementsByTagName('li')[0]);
c.scrollLeft = 0;
};
},
speed = 50; //数值越大越慢
ul.style.width = width*itemCount + 'px'; //加载完后设置容器长度
var timer = setInterval(marquee, speed);
c.onmouseover = function() {
clearInterval(timer);
};
c.onmouseout = function() {
timer = setInterval(marquee, speed);
};
};
然后在主页文件"index.html”中添加对该“MoveEffect.js”文件的引用。
script type="text/javascript" src="MoveEffect.js"/script
打开“index.html”网页文件,最终效果如果所示:

在html中如何让图片跟着滚动条而动
1、新建一个文件夹,用来存放网页文件和图片,快捷键ctrl+shift+n。
2、进入新建文件夹里面,右键新建文本文档。
3、进入新建的文本文档,复制下方代码,点击快捷键ctrl+s保存后退出。
!doctype html
html
head
meta charset="utf-8"
title百度知道/title
/head
body
!--
position:fixed;是设置为固定在页面的某个位置,不会随滚动条滚动而移动。
top: 50px;图片距离页面顶部50像素。
right:10px;图片距离页面右边10像素。
display:block;设置图片为块状元素,这样图片不会单独占据行--
img style="position:fixed;top: 50px;right:10px;display:block;" src="1.png" alt=""
p百度知道/pp百度知道/pp百度知道/pp百度知道/pp百度知道/pp百度知道/p
p百度知道/pp百度知道/pp百度知道/pp百度知道/pp百度知道/pp百度知道/p
p百度知道/pp百度知道/pp百度知道/pp百度知道/pp百度知道/pp百度知道/p
p百度知道/pp百度知道/pp百度知道/pp百度知道/pp百度知道/pp百度知道/p
p百度知道/pp百度知道/pp百度知道/pp百度知道/pp百度知道/pp百度知道/p
p百度知道/pp百度知道/pp百度知道/pp百度知道/pp百度知道/pp百度知道/p
p百度知道/pp百度知道/pp百度知道/pp百度知道/pp百度知道/pp百度知道/p
/body
/html
4、重命名新建文本文档为index.html,原先的.txt的后缀同时去掉后保存,提示确实要更改后按“是”即可。
5、添加背景图片源文件,并命名为1.png,这些图片为你需要放置的图片。
6、点击index.html,右键浏览器打开预览效果。
7、浏览器打开后即可得到如下效果
html怎么设置滚动图片?
方案一:直接使用HTML的滚动标签 marquee ,把图片放入滚滚标签内部,代码如下:
marquee
img src='1.jpg'
img src='2.jpg'
img src='3.jpg'
img src='4.jpg'
/marquee
方案二:使用第三方插件,比如swiper.js,
插件
HTML 图片闪烁????
多定义几张图片,每秒从中随机抽一张,也就是每秒都改变 img 标签的src值,就可以做到闪动了。
html如何使图片移动
需要准备的材料分别有:电脑、浏览器、html编辑器。
1、首先,打开html编辑器,新建html文件,例如:index.html。
2、在index.html中的body标签中,输入html代码:img style="margin-top: 100px" src="small2.png" /。
3、浏览器运行index.html页面,此时图片被向下移动了100px。
html中鼠标放上去图片上下跳动一下
浏览器内系统内部的设置和鼠标系统内部设置共同形成的结果。根据查询相关公开信息显示在html中鼠标放上去图片上下跳动一下的现象是浏览器内系统内部的设置和鼠标系统内部设置共同形成的结果。HTML的全称为超文本标记语言,是一种标记语言。
html制作图片跳动的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于html图片跳转、html制作图片跳动的信息别忘了在本站进行查找喔。
